Stiffener plates are welded to the column flanges with typical corner clips and specified minimum dimensions. A gusset plate connects centrally to the column web and flanges, featuring a transition taper with a typical one-inch radius. Welds develop the full capacity of the stiffener plates per structural notes. Where beam flanges exceed the space between column flanges, transition details apply.
